The week of Sept. 18-24 will be marked to honor the National Guard and Reserve, President Barack Obama said Friday.

Obama issued a proclamation calling on state and local officials, private organizations and military commanders to hold ceremonies and events in observation of National Employer Support of the Guard and Reserve Week.

“These patriots serve not only in combat, but also when disaster strikes at home, offering a strong hand to victims of floods, tornadoes, and fires across America,” Obama said.

This year, Michelle Obama and Dr. Jill Biden announced Joining Forces, helping to connect service members, veterans, and their families to employment opportunities.
